Common Concrete Sealer Issues and Solutions

It has become common practice to use a clear or colored concrete sealer for both domestic and commercial projects. Driveways, garages, walkways, and flooring are among the common places where sealers are used. Sealers are an excellent technique to increase slip resistance, shield the concrete surface from deterioration, and make cleaning easier. The failure of concrete sealers, however, can occur for a number of reasons and is rarely fixed by just adding another coat.

Problem: White or hazy areas under the concrete sealer Before the sealer was applied, there was typically too much moisture on the concrete's surface.  


Solution:

Scrub thinners into the troubled regions to fix it. Hopefully, this will reactivate the sealant and let the moisture escape. Several applications might be necessary. Failing that, a stronger reactivating solvent you may require. Otherwise, the coating will be stripped off and reapplied.  


Problem: Observable White Salt Specks on the Concrete Sealant's Surface

Efflorescence refers to something like this. The evaporation or drying of moisture carries these salts, these forms during the curing process, to the concrete's surface.  


Powdery salt deposits may also be caused by groundwater-soluble salts that, when subjected to hydrostatic pressure, seep through concrete. Sealers can delaminate in small sections when there are extremely high concentrations of groundwater salt present because of the crystallization of salts between the sealer and the concrete, especially if the concrete has not been properly prepared and the sealer does not key into the surface. This is frequently seen next to flowerbeds or in locations where there is considerable groundwater hydrostatic pressure as a result of ground slope and level differences.  


Solution:  


Since these salts are typically water soluble, water you can use to wash them away. Cleaning might be you can do by using a very dilute solution of 1-part hydrochloric acid to 100 parts waters. After acid washing, carefully flush and scrub the area. Even with one or two coatings of sealer, efflorescent salts may still develop, especially if there is a hydrostatic supply of salt-containing ground moisture. If the first layer has sufficient adhesion, three or more coatings will typically be necessary to block the salts.  


Problem: Concrete Sealer is Coming Off  


This happens due to poor planning or a flimsy concrete surface.  


Solution: Check to check whether there are any debris or concrete fragments on the rear of the flaking sealer. However, if this is the case, scrub the surface vigorously or use a high-pressure washer to remove all flaky debris. Apply two diluted coatings of sealer when it has dried, then a straight coat.  


Problem: Silvering Flaky Concrete Sealer   

Silvering Flaky Concrete Sealer

An adhesion issue you can easily with identify by scratching the sealer and looking for flaking or powdery sealant. 

 

Solution: There will need to be resealing. Before resealing or applying a seal repair solution, stripping you can do.  


Issue: A bubbling or Bursting Sealant  


This typically happens when the sealer applies to too-hot concrete.  

Solution: Simply remove the bubbles from the surface and then, after the surface has cooled, add another coat.  


What Is Concrete Protective Coating?

Concrete Protective Coating

A concrete protective coating is any material that helps shield a concrete surface from harm such as normal wear and tear, cracking, moisture, storm damage, abrasion, damage from harsh chemicals, and more. Moreover, concrete surfaces outside may treat with a few coats of paint, if necessary. On commonly used surfaces like concrete floors, merely painting them is frequently insufficient.  


While aesthetics is important, safeguarding concrete surfaces—especially floors—is essential to reducing the aforementioned occurrences as well as contamination of the floor space in specific situations, such as those involving the preparation of food. Another crucial element is making a floor non-slip, which is crucial in commercial settings where there is a potential that water or other moisture will get on the flooring and make it hazardous.
